Step-by-Step Process
-
Prepare the Gummy Bears: Toss those gummy bears into a mixing bowl. If you’re using fruit, chop it up and add it here too!
-
Mix the Sprite: In another bowl, pour your chilled Sprite (trust me, chilling it helps) and stir gently.
-
Assemble the pops: now, let's get crafty! pour a splash of that sprite into each popsicle mold—just enough to fill it about a quarter full.
Add your gummy bears (and fruit if you’re using it) until you’ve got a nice layer. then, finish filling them up with sprite.
-
Insert Sticks and Freeze: Put your sticks in and freeze those pops for about *4 hours *—or until they’re solid as a rock.
-
Unmold and Enjoy: Need a tip? Run warm water over the outside of the molds to help release those pops smoothly. Then dig in!

Storage & Make-Ahead Magic
So, you made too many pops—no shame in that! just store them in a freezer-safe bag or container. i always recommend placing a small piece of parchment paper between the pops before storing to help with separation.
They can last about 2-4 weeks in the freezer without losing their icy charm. but let’s be real; they’ll probably be gone before then!
When it’s time to enjoy these frozen goodies—just run warm water over the sides of the mold if they’re stubborn. No more fighting with a hard popsicle. Smooth moves only!

Frozen Gummy Bears in Sprite Pops Card
⚖️ Ingredients:
- 2 cups (475 ml) Sprite (or any lemon-lime soda)
- 1 cup (200 g) gummy bears (various flavors)
- ½ cup (75 g) diced strawberries, blueberries, or any favorite fruit (optional)
🥄 Instructions:
- Step 1: Pour the gummy bears into a mixing bowl. If adding fruit, chop into small pieces and add to the bowl.
- Step 2: Pour the Sprite into a larger mixing bowl. Stir gently to combine with any added fruit if using.
- Step 3: Pour a small amount of Sprite into each popsicle mold (about ¼ full). Add an even layer of gummy bears on top. Fill the molds with Sprite until full, ensuring gummy bears are suspended.
- Step 4: Place sticks into the center of each popsicle (if using molds with lids, secure the lid). Freeze for at least 4 hours, or until completely solid.
- Step 5: To release, run warm water over the outside of the mold for a few seconds. Pull pops from the molds and enjoy immediately!
